The Realme P3 5G features a durable, IP68-rated plastic body available in sleek gray and green finishes, blending practicality with modern aesthetics. Its 8.0mm thickness and 194g weight strike a balance between portability and sturdiness, while the 87% screen-to-body ratio ensures immersive visuals via the 6.7-inch AMOLED display with a hole-punch notch. The 2.5D curved glass and slim bezels enhance the premium feel, complemented by a robust build that withstands everyday wear. The device’s water and dust resistance, coupled with a scratch-resistant screen, makes it a resilient choice for users prioritizing longevity without compromising on style or functionality. The Realme P3 5G houses a 5260mAh Li-Polymer battery with 45W fast charging, ensuring rapid power replenishment and extended usage. Its high-capacity design supports all-day performance, while reverse charging enables wireless power sharing with other devices. The battery’s non-removable construction and IP68 rating enhance durability, safeguarding against spills and dust. With efficient power management and a 4nm processor, the device balances performance and energy conservation. Whether streaming, gaming, or multitasking, the P3 5G delivers reliable endurance, making it a dependable companion for users who demand longevity without frequent recharging. The Realme P3 5G features a stunning 6.7-inch AMOLED display with a 20:9 aspect ratio, delivering vibrant, lifelike colors and deep blacks. Its FHD+ resolution (1080 x 2400 pixels) and 395 PPI pixel density ensure sharp, detailed visuals, while the 120Hz refresh rate and 180Hz touch sampling enable smooth scrolling and responsive interactions. The screen’s peak brightness of 2000 nits ensures visibility even in direct sunlight, and DCI-P3 color support enhances cinematic accuracy. A 2.5D curved glass design adds a premium feel, complemented by a hole-punch notch that maximizes screen real estate. With a 600 cd/m² typical brightness, HDR compatibility, and a 87% screen-to-body ratio, the display balances immersive performance with durability, thanks to its scratch-resistant coating and IP68-rated protection. The Realme P3 5G offers a versatile dual-camera system with a 50MP main lens featuring f/1.8 aperture and advanced imaging capabilities. The primary sensor supports 4K video recording, HDR, digital zoom, and dual image stabilization, ensuring sharp, vibrant photos even in challenging lighting. Complementing it is a 2MP macro lens for close-up shots, adding creative flexibility. The front-facing 16MP camera (f/2.4 aperture) delivers clear selfies and video calls, though it lacks 4K resolution. While the rear setup excels in dynamic range and stabilization, the absence of optical zoom or stabilization limits low-light performance. Features like scene modes and digital zoom enhance usability for casual photography. The Realme P3 5G’s Qualcomm Snapdragon 6 Gen 4 (4nm) ensures efficient handling of daily tasks, paired with 8GB LPDDR4X RAM and 256GB UFS 3.1 storage for smooth app performance and file access. While capable for multimedia and light multitasking, its mid-range chipset struggles with intensive gaming or heavy workloads. A 12GB/512GB variant in India offers enhanced capacity, but global models remain optimized for balanced, energy-efficient operation. The device prioritizes practicality over raw power, making it suitable for users seeking reliable, no-frills performance without compromising on battery life or connectivity.
